PREAKNESS PREVIEW | Baltimore Police prepare in neighborhood that has struggled with crime

0



All eyes are on the Preakness Stakes happening Saturday. The race gives a chance for Baltimore to showcase the city as people from across the country come in. As the big race looms, police are telling FOX45 News what we can expect to see regarding security at the track and surrounding community.

At the corner of Hayward Avenue and Winner Avenue, Danielle Miles and her mother, Eraina Spady, have food on the grill ready for sale. Their location on the block is prime for Preakness.

“We’re the last ones they see going in and the first one they see when you coming out. So, that makes for good business,” said Miles.
